Syncthing电脑版下载和安装教程(附安装包)

Syncthing 安装包下载地址:Syncthing 安装包(Windows+Linux+macOS)

Syncthing 是一款开源的连续文件同步程序,采用点对点(P2P)技术,允许用户在多台设备之间直接同步文件,无需通过第三方中央服务器。这意味着你的数据完全掌握在自己手中,不会存储在任何云端服务商的服务器上,从根本上杜绝了隐私泄露的风险。

Syncthing的核心特点包括:
  1. 去中心化架构,数据自主可控:与传统的云存储服务(如百度网盘、Dropbox)不同,Syncthing 不会在第三方服务器上存储你的任何文件,这种模式不仅保护了隐私,还避免了服务商倒闭、数据丢失或审查的风险。
  2. 全平台支持,无缝跨设备协作:无论你使用 Windows、macOS、Linux,还是 Android 设备,Syncthing 都能完美运行。
  3. 智能同步机制:Syncthing 采用"块级同步"技术,当文件发生修改时,它不会重新传输整个文件,而是只传输发生变化的数据块。这不仅大大节省了带宽,也提高了同步速度。

Resilio Sync(原名 BitTorrent Sync)是 Syncthing 最主要的竞争对手,两者都主打 P2P 文件同步,但在多个维度上存在显著差异:

对比维度 Syncthing Resilio Sync
授权模式 完全开源免费(MPL-2.0协议) 闭源软件,免费版有功能限制
核心协议 自研开源协议,透明可审计 基于 BitTorrent 专有协议
隐私保护 极致隐私,无中央服务器,代码公开 同样无中央服务器,但代码不公开
同步性能 日常文件同步表现优秀,大文件稍慢 大文件和大量文件同步速度更快
移动端支持 官方 Android 应用优秀,iOS需第三方 官方全平台客户端,体验统一
易用性 初始配置需学习,但功能强大 界面更精致,新手更友好
长期成本 永久免费,无订阅费用 高级功能需付费订阅

如果你重视数据隐私、喜欢开源透明、希望零成本长期使用,Syncthing 是最佳选择。

下载Syncthing

Syncthing 安装包下载地址:Syncthing 安装包(Windows+Linux+macOS)

安装Syncthing

1) 下载 syncthing-windows-386-v2.0.16-rc.1.zip,然后解压;

2) 双击 syncthing.exe 即可运行,会自动打开浏览器访问 http://127.0.0.1:8384 进行配置。

Syncthing基础使用

首次访问 Syncthing 的 Web 界面(http://127.0.0.1:8384),你会看到一个欢迎页面和设置向导。

第一步:初始配置

1) 为了安全起见,强烈建议为 Web 管理界面设置访问密码:
  1. 点击右上角的"操作"(Actions)菜单,选择"设置"(Settings)。
  2. 切换到"图形用户界面"(GUI)选项卡。
  3. 在"用户名"和"密码"栏输入你想要设置的登录凭据。
  4. 点击"保存"(Save)。

2) 了解设备 ID。每个 Syncthing 实例都有一个唯一的设备 ID(长字符串,如 ABC123-DEF456-GHI789)。这是设备的身份标识,用于与其他设备建立信任关系。你可以在 Web 界面右上角看到当前设备的 ID,点击"显示 ID"可以查看二维码,方便手机扫描添加。

第二步:添加远程设备

Syncthing 的核心是设备之间的配对。假设你有两台电脑 A 和 B,需要让它们互相识别:
  1. 在电脑 A 上: 点击"添加远程设备"(Add Remote Device)按钮。
  2. 输入设备 ID: 在"设备 ID"栏输入电脑 B 的设备 ID(可以在电脑 B 的 Syncthing 界面找到)。
  3. 设置设备名: 给这台设备起个容易识别的名字,如"办公室电脑"或"家里NAS"。
  4. 保存: 点击保存。

此时,电脑 B 的 Syncthing 界面会弹出"新设备请求"通知,显示电脑 A 希望连接。点击"添加设备",确认配对。这样,两台设备就建立了信任关系。

注意事项:

第三步:设置共享文件夹

设备配对完成后,接下来需要设置要同步的文件夹:
  1. 添加文件夹: 点击"添加文件夹"(Add Folder)按钮。
  2. 设置文件夹标签: 输入一个友好的名称,如"工作文档"或"照片备份"。
  3. 选择文件夹路径: 点击"浏览"选择本地要同步的文件夹路径。
  4. 选择共享设备: 在"共享"选项卡中,勾选你希望共享此文件夹的设备。
  5. 高级设置(可选):
    • 文件版本控制: 建议选择"简单文件版本控制",保留最近几个版本,防止误删。
    • 忽略模式: 可以设置忽略特定文件或文件夹,如临时文件、缓存文件等。
  6. 保存: 点击保存。

在对方设备上,会收到"共享文件夹请求",确认后,双方就会开始同步该文件夹的内容。

常见问题与解决方案

问题1:设备无法连接,显示"断开连接"

问题2:同步速度很慢

问题3:文件冲突

当同一文件在多个设备上同时被修改时,会产生冲突。Syncthing 会自动保留两个版本,并在文件名中标记冲突。你需要手动合并或选择保留哪个版本。

问题4:数据库锁定错误

如果 Syncthing 异常退出,可能会留下锁文件导致无法启动。解决方法是删除 ~/.config/syncthing/index-v0.14.0.db/LOCK 文件(Linux/macOS)或对应 Windows 路径下的 LOCK 文件,然后重启。

总结

Syncthing 是一款真正意义上的"数据自主"工具。在这个云服务商频繁审查、限速、甚至倒闭的时代,拥有一个完全由自己控制的文件同步解决方案显得尤为重要。

Syncthing 不仅免费开源,而且功能强大、安全可靠,足以满足从个人用户到小型团队的各种同步需求。

如果你是第一次使用 Syncthing,建议从两台设备开始,如同步你的主力电脑和笔记本电脑。先同步一个不重要的测试文件夹,熟悉配对、共享、版本控制等基本操作后,再逐步扩展到其他设备和重要数据。

如有侵权请【联系站长】,会第一时间处理。